/kernel/linux/linux-5.10/drivers/net/ethernet/mscc/ |
H A D | ocelot_net.c | 334 val = ocelot_read(ocelot, QS_INJ_STATUS); in ocelot_port_xmit() 486 stats->rx_bytes = ocelot_read(ocelot, SYS_COUNT_RX_OCTETS); in ocelot_get_stats64() 487 stats->rx_packets = ocelot_read(ocelot, SYS_COUNT_RX_SHORTS) + in ocelot_get_stats64() 488 ocelot_read(ocelot, SYS_COUNT_RX_FRAGMENTS) + in ocelot_get_stats64() 489 ocelot_read(ocelot, SYS_COUNT_RX_JABBERS) + in ocelot_get_stats64() 490 ocelot_read(ocelot, SYS_COUNT_RX_LONGS) + in ocelot_get_stats64() 491 ocelot_read(ocelot, SYS_COUNT_RX_64) + in ocelot_get_stats64() 492 ocelot_read(ocelot, SYS_COUNT_RX_65_127) + in ocelot_get_stats64() 493 ocelot_read(ocelot, SYS_COUNT_RX_128_255) + in ocelot_get_stats64() 494 ocelot_read(ocelo in ocelot_get_stats64() [all...] |
H A D | ocelot.c | 23 return ocelot_read(ocelot, ANA_TABLES_MACACCESS); in ocelot_mact_read_macaccess() 135 return ocelot_read(ocelot, ANA_TABLES_VLANACCESS); in ocelot_vlant_read_vlanaccess() 548 val = ocelot_read(ocelot, SYS_PTP_TXSTAMP); in ocelot_get_hwtimestamp() 570 val = ocelot_read(ocelot, SYS_PTP_STATUS); in ocelot_get_txtstamp() 711 val = ocelot_read(ocelot, ANA_TABLES_MACACCESS); in ocelot_mact_read() 723 macl = ocelot_read(ocelot, ANA_TABLES_MACLDATA); in ocelot_mact_read() 724 mach = ocelot_read(ocelot, ANA_TABLES_MACHDATA); in ocelot_mact_read()
|
H A D | ocelot_vsc7514.c | 608 if (!(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p))) in ocelot_xtr_irq_handler() 706 } while (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p)); in ocelot_xtr_irq_handler() 709 while (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p)) in ocelot_xtr_irq_handler()
|
/kernel/linux/linux-6.6/drivers/net/ethernet/mscc/ |
H A D | ocelot.c | 33 return ocelot_read(ocelot, ANA_TABLES_MACACCESS); in ocelot_mact_read_macaccess() 160 val = ocelot_read(ocelot, ANA_TABLES_MACACCESS); in ocelot_mact_lookup() 292 return ocelot_read(ocelot, ANA_TABLES_VLANACCESS); in ocelot_vlant_read_vlanaccess() 1185 u32 val = ocelot_read(ocelot, QS_INJ_STATUS); in ocelot_can_inject() 1250 while (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p)) in ocelot_drain_cpu_queue() 1295 val = ocelot_read(ocelot, ANA_TABLES_MACACCESS); in ocelot_mact_read() 1307 macl = ocelot_read(ocelot, ANA_TABLES_MACLDATA); in ocelot_mact_read() 1308 mach = ocelot_read(ocelot, ANA_TABLES_MACHDATA); in ocelot_mact_read() 2868 mmgt = ocelot_read(ocelot, SYS_MMGT); in ocelot_detect_features() 2871 eq_ctrl = ocelot_read(ocelo in ocelot_detect_features() [all...] |
H A D | ocelot_ptp.c | 723 val = ocelot_read(ocelot, SYS_PTP_TXSTAMP); in ocelot_get_hwtimestamp() 756 val = ocelot_read(ocelot, SYS_PTP_STATUS); in ocelot_get_txtstamp()
|
H A D | ocelot_vsc7514.c | 54 while (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p)) { in ocelot_xtr_irq_handler()
|
H A D | ocelot_net.c | 841 val = ocelot_read(ocelot, ANA_VLANMASK); in ocelot_vlan_mode()
|
/kernel/linux/linux-6.6/drivers/net/dsa/ocelot/ |
H A D | felix_vsc9959.c | 890 return ocelot_read(ocelot, SYS_RAM_INIT); in vsc9959_sys_ram_init_status() 1404 return ocelot_read(ocelot, QSYS_TAS_PARAM_CFG_CTRL); in vsc9959_tas_read_cfg_status() 1477 val = ocelot_read(ocelot, QSYS_PARAM_STATUS_REG_8); in vsc9959_qos_port_tas_set() 1888 return ocelot_read(ocelot, ANA_TABLES_SFIDACCESS); in vsc9959_sfi_access_status() 2101 return ocelot_read(ocelot, ANA_SG_ACCESS_CTRL); in vsc9959_sgi_cfg_status() 2446 match = ocelot_read(ocelot, SYS_COUNT_SF_MATCHING_FRAMES); in vsc9959_update_sfid_stats() 2447 not_pass_gate = ocelot_read(ocelot, SYS_COUNT_SF_NOT_PASSING_FRAMES); in vsc9959_update_sfid_stats() 2448 not_pass_sdu = ocelot_read(ocelot, SYS_COUNT_SF_NOT_PASSING_SDU); in vsc9959_update_sfid_stats() 2449 red = ocelot_read(ocelot, SYS_COUNT_SF_RED_FRAMES); in vsc9959_update_sfid_stats()
|
H A D | felix.c | 1674 while (ocelot_read(ocelot, QS_XTR_DATA_PRESENT) & BIT(grp)) { in felix_check_xtr_pkt()
|
/kernel/linux/linux-5.10/drivers/net/dsa/ocelot/ |
H A D | felix_vsc9959.c | 902 return ocelot_read(ocelot, SYS_RAM_INIT); in vsc9959_sys_ram_init_status() 1178 return ocelot_read(ocelot, QSYS_TAS_PARAM_CFG_CTRL); in vsc9959_tas_read_cfg_status() 1224 val = ocelot_read(ocelot, QSYS_PARAM_STATUS_REG_8); in vsc9959_qos_port_tas_set()
|
H A D | seville_vsc9953.c | 950 val = ocelot_read(ocelot, GCB_MIIM_MII_DATA); in vsc9953_mdio_read()
|
/kernel/linux/linux-5.10/include/soc/mscc/ |
H A D | ocelot.h | 668 #define ocelot_read(ocelot, reg) __ocelot_read_ix(ocelot, reg, 0) macro
|
/kernel/linux/linux-6.6/include/soc/mscc/ |
H A D | ocelot.h | 905 #define ocelot_read(ocelot, reg) \ macro
|